Rebekah Isaacs Commission


The Granite State Comicon was two weeks ago and I will reiterate that I had a phenomenal time. I shopped, bought comics, and met great creators.

One of the ones I was eager to meet was Rebekah Isaacs. Isaacs is most famous for her work with Christos Gage on the Buffy spin-off Angel & Faith book. And boy, she brings it on that book, a great mix of quiet moments and horror.

Now I will admit, I was struggling with the list of names of who I should get commissions from. And then, people whose opinion I value tremendously, told me I would be foolish not to move Isaacs to the top of the list. It was Diabolu Frank from the Idol Head of Diabolu that was the straw that broke the camel's back.

And I have to thank each and every one of those people. Because of their advice, I did move Isaacs to the top of the list, contacted her before the con, had my name penciled onto her list, and got this great commission.

Whereas the Aaron Kuder commission from the show is an action shot, this Isaacs piece focuses on the angelic nature of Supergirl. This is absolutely saintly, eyes closed, hands low, floating amongst the sun rays and doves. It is wonderful. Wonderful.


And Isaacs was very cool to talk to.

I have always loved this Archie-style cover of Angel and Faith #20, such an perfectly odd cover for 2 vampires and a vampire slayer. And Faith's expression is perfect.
